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Alteryx
- Starter is $250 per user per month billed annually, and the Professional and Enterprise editions are quote-only
- Automation runs are metered, with 50 included on Starter and 15,000 on Professional, and more must be bought
- Cost depends on three separate dimensions at once: edition, user role and automation capacity
- Advanced analytics, governance and orchestration are withheld from the entry edition
Vespa
- Pricing not publicly listed, requires contacting sales
- Steeper learning curve compared to simpler search tools
- Operational complexity for self-hosted deployments
- Smaller ecosystem compared to cloud-native alternatives

Answered from the vendors’ own pages
Alteryx: How much does Alteryx Starter cost?
Alteryx Starter Edition costs $250 USD per user per month when billed annually, for teams of 1-10 users.
SourceVespa: Is Vespa open-source?
Yes, Vespa is open-source under the Apache 2.0 license. The code is available on GitHub, and you can self-host or use the managed cloud service.
SourceAlteryx: Is there a free trial for Alteryx?
Yes, Alteryx offers a 30-day free trial to evaluate the platform before committing to a paid plan.
SourceVespa: What latency can Vespa achieve?
Vespa is designed for sub-100 millisecond latencies with thousands of queries per second, suitable for real-time search and recommendation applications.
SourceAlteryx: What differentiates Alteryx Professional from Starter?
Professional Edition supports both Basic and Full user roles, includes 15,000 automation runs, offers cloud and desktop deployment, connects to 100+ data sources, and enables advanced data preparation and macros. Professional and Enterprise editions require contacting sales for pricing.
SourceVespa: Does Vespa support vector search?
Yes, Vespa provides native vector search capabilities alongside text, structured data, and tensor operations for building comprehensive search and AI applications.
SourceVespa: What is the pricing model for Vespa Cloud?
Vespa Cloud pricing is not publicly listed and requires contacting their sales team to discuss your specific use case and scale requirements.
